Brainly What is the fraction in simplest form? 14/16

Mathematics
1 answer:
Stels [109]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

\frac{7}{8}

Step-by-step explanation:

we have

\frac{14}{16}

we know that

14=2*7

16=2^{4}

substitute

\frac{2*7}{2^{4}}

Simplify

\frac{2*7}{2^{4}}=\frac{7}{2^{3}}=\frac{7}{8}

Out of a random sample of 2,000 people in the United States, 168 reported making more than $75,000 a year. Calculate the sample
Mandarinka [93]

Answer:

The sample proportion is 8.4%.

Step-by-step explanation:

The sample proportion f people in the United States who earn more than $75,000 each year is the number of people who reported earning more than $75,000 each year divided by the size of the sample.

The proportion is:

P = \frac{168}{2000} = 0.084

The sample proportion is 8.4%.
